To keep sandwiches from getting soggy, start by spreading a thin layer of condiments or spreads on the bread rather than piling them on. Use ingredients that have a low moisture content, such as lettuce, cheese, and cured meats. Place wet ingredients, such as tomato or cucumber slices, between dry ingredients to create a barrier. Avoid packing the sandwich too tightly in a plastic container or wrapping too tightly in plastic wrap, as this can trap moisture and cause sogginess. Consider using a crusty bread or toasting the bread slightly before assembling the sandwich.
